Dr. Jessica Flayer, licensed professional counselor, is responsible for providing mental health counseling and performance consultations to student-athletes. In her role at Arizona, she also consults with coaches and works within the interdisciplinary sport medicine staff to improve treatment outcomes.

Flayer earned her bachelor’s degree from Texas Lutheran University, moving on to obtain her Master’s in Clinical Mental Health Counseling at Northern Arizona University. She furthered her education by obtaining her Doctor of Philosophy in General Psychology with an emphasis in Performance Psychology from Grand Canyon University. Her dissertation at GCU examined the transition out of sport and athletic retirement for collegiate student-athletes.
 
Flayer has spent much of her professional experience supporting client’s in addressing anxiety disorders, mood disorders, and trauma using validated treatment interventions. Prior to her role at Arizona, Flayer worked in private practice specializing in working with athletes at the elite youth, collegiate, and professional levels as well as working with first responders.
